Membrane Dynamics Overview
The structural setup of a cell membrane consisting of hydrophilic polar heads, hydrophobic nonpolar tails, water-based fluid, and protein transporters.
Diffusion
The movement of particles to spread out from areas of high concentration to areas of low concentration until equilibrium is reached.
Equilibrium
The state achieved when particles become evenly spread throughout a space.
Proportional Symbol (∝)
A mathematical symbol representing a proportional relationship between variables.

Factors Directly Proportional to Diffusion Rate
Concentration gradient, surface area, and membrane permeability, which all increase the rate of diffusion as they increase.
Inversely Proportional Factor of Diffusion
Membrane thickness, which decreases the rate of diffusion as it increases (\text{Inversely Proportional} \reflectbox{\rightarrow} \frac{1}{\text{Membrane thickness}}).
Hydrophilic
Water-attracting property associated with the polar heads of the membrane structure.
Hydrophobic
Water-repelling property associated with the nonpolar region of the membrane structure.
Protein Transporters
Structures embedded in the cell membrane that facilitate transport across the lipid bilayer.
